I'm trying to help a friend who has a CNC machine.
He wants to use the Mach3 closed loop speed control to control the speed of his router.
I know very little about Mach3 - I'm giving him advice on the electronics issues.
Could someone please point me to a description of what type of feedback signal the Mach3 PWM speed control needs.
I assume it is pulses derived from an optical shaft speed detector.
Also, how is it connected to the computer?
I have a copy of Mach3Mill_Install_Config.pdf but it lacks detail on the speed control function.
Any advice will be appreciated.

Afraid I know nothing about the PWM type speed control in Mach as I use Step/Dir with Servos. Having said that the only feedback to Mach for any spindle speed monitoring is a single pulse per rev that you input via the Index input.
